🔧 1. On-Site Repair Capability — We Bring the Process to YOU

Most plating and repair solutions require dismantling, packing, transporting, and waiting.
Sterling’s Brush Plating does the opposite.

We repair components directly on-site:

✔ Hydraulic shafts & rods (marine cranes, RTGs, STS, construction equipment)

✔ Engine blocks, diesel generator bedplate main bearing saddles

✔ Printing cylinders & industrial rollers

✔ Large mechanical parts too heavy or too expensive to move

No dismantling.
No shipping.
No downtime waiting for external workshops.

We bring our portable Brush Plating system straight to your equipment, complete repairs within hours or days, and get your machinery back online faster than any conventional method.

🛢️ 3. Anti-Galling Solutions Approved by Global OCTG Manufacturers

In the oilfield industry, coating quality isn’t optional — it’s a compliance requirement.

Sterling’s Brush Plating process is:

✔ Approved and qualified by major OCTG manufacturers
✔ Used globally for premium & non-premium connections
✔ Proven to prevent galling during make-up & break-out
✔ Capable of passing 200-bar water jet adhesion tests
✔ Trusted by oil tool threading and machining companies worldwide

When drilling operations depend on reliable torque, flawless make-up, and long-lasting thread protection — Sterling’s anti-galling copper Brush Plating is the industry benchmark.
